Adam Gray’s response to a basic question about Newsom’s redistricting plan speaks volumes.

When a constituent pressed Rep. Adam Gray on whether he supports Governor Gavin Newsom’s mid-decade redistricting effort widely criticized as a power grab to lock in Democratic advantages and further dilute Republican representation Gray did not answer. Instead, video shows him blocking the person’s phone to stop the recording.

He ducked the question about backing a scheme that critics say is designed to entrench one-party control in California, including in competitive seats like his own (which he won by a razor-thin margin after prolonged ballot counting). Rather than defend or explain his position, he tried to shut down the record of the exchange.
Elected officials who answer to voters should not put their hand in front of a phone the moment accountability arrives. Blocking recording when asked about redrawing maps for partisan gain looks like the opposite of transparency. Californians deserve straight answers on whether their representatives support changing the rules mid-cycle to favor one side not physical obstruction of the question itself.

If the plan is defensible, defend it on camera. If it isn’t, that refusal and the attempt to stop the recording are the story.
